English Framed Watercolor by Eric Leazell

About the Item

A wonderful original watercolor still life by painter Eric Leazell, signed by the artist. Eric “Lee” Leazell was a 20th century British artist born in 1933. He had a highly prolific career painting in oils and watercolor. His paintings are in private collections and have sold at auctions around the world. He passed away in 2011 at the age of 78. A lovely watercolor still life of red poppies in a clear glass vase positioned in front of a white column and a lively green foliage background. Beautifully rendered with superb brushwork and tones, this highly collectible watercolor would be the perfect addition to a sitting room, guest bedroom, or breakfast nook. According to the Encyclopædia Britannica Eleventh Edition, ""Varley's landscapes are graceful and solemn in feeling, and simple and broad in treatment, being worked with a full brush and pure fresh transparent tints, usually without any admixture of body-colour. Though his works are rather mannered and conventional, they are well considered and excellent in composition. Some of his earlier water-colours, including his ""Views of the Thames,"" were painted upon the spot, and possess greater individuality than his later productions, which are mainly compositions of mountain and lake scenery, produced without direct reference to nature.""
